Is the 2021 MERCEDES A reliable?
Excellent reliability. Very few MOT failures. That's 12 points above the national average of 82%. It also outperforms the MERCEDES brand average of 87%.
At 3 years old, 94% of MERCEDES As from 2021 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 37,477 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 26,277 miles.

About the 2021 MERCEDES A
The 2021 MERCEDES A is a family car with a 1991cc petrol engine. 37,477 of these vehicles were MOT tested in 2024, making it one of the most commonly tested cars on UK roads. Among all cars from 2021, the average MOT pass rate is 92%, and this model beats that benchmark.
With an average of 26,277 miles at 3 years old, MERCEDES A owners drive about as much as the UK average.
2021 MERCEDES A Fuel Costs
The 1991cc petrol engine offers a reasonable balance between performance and economy. Expect around 36 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,327 per year at current petrol prices of 142p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year).
What does it cost to own a 2021 MERCEDES A?
Total estimated annual running cost is £1,772 (£148/month), broken down as £1327 fuel, £190 road tax, £55 MOT, and £200 predicted repairs. The low repair estimate reflects the excellent 94% pass rate. These cars rarely fail their MOT, so unexpected bills are less likely.
